Allow hook callbacks to modify event properties to change agent behavior, achieving parity with the Python SDK. Hook callbacks can now modify: - BeforeToolCallEvent.tool - Change which tool gets executed - BeforeToolCallEvent.toolUse - Modify tool parameters before execution - AfterToolCallEvent.result - Transform tool results before sending to model This enables use cases like tool routing, parameter validation, result transformation, and conditional behavior changes without modifying tool implementations. Motivation
The Python SDK allows hook callbacks to modify event properties to change agent behavior (e.g., switching tools, modifying parameters, transforming results), but the TypeScript SDK marked these properties as readonly. This prevented users from implementing similar behavior modification patterns and created an API inconsistency between the two SDKs.

Public API Changes
The following hook event properties are now writable, allowing hook callbacks to modify agent behavior:
BeforeToolCallEvent:
AfterToolCallEvent:
The changes are backward compatible. Existing hooks that only read properties continue to work without modification.
